What Happens When A Cv Axle Breaks . Let us discuss the symptoms of cv axle failure, how to diagnose the issue, and why it is better to replace the entire axle assembly. The constant velocity axle, or cv axle, connects your wheels to the transaxle or transmission, allowing your vehicle to drive. If your car's axle breaks during driving, your car will be immobile.
